All Classes and Interfaces

Class
Description
An archive that can be launched by the Launcher.
Represents a single entry in the archive.
Wrapper for Cleaner providing registration support.
Provides read access to a block of data contained somewhere in a zip file.
Simple logger class used for System.err debugging.
Base class for a Launcher backed by an executable archive.
URLStreamHandler alternative to sun.net.www.protocol.jar.Handler with optimized support for nested jars.
URLStreamHandler to support nested: URLs.
Utility used to register loader URL handlers.
Launcher for JAR based archives.
Interface registered in spring.factories to provides extended 'jarmode' support.
Simple RuntimeException used to fail the jar mode with a simple printed error message.
Utility class with factory methods that can be used to create JAR URLs.
URLClassLoader with optimized support for Jar URLs.
ClassLoader used by the Launcher.
Base class for launchers that can start an application with a fully configured classpath.
FileSystemProvider implementation for nested jar files.
Extended variant of JarFile that behaves in the same way but can open nested jars.
A location obtained from a nested: URL consisting of a jar file and an optional nested entry.
Launcher for archives with user-configured classpath and main class through a properties file.
Utility to decode URL strings.
Launcher for WAR based archives.
Provides raw access to content from a regular or nested zip file.
Zip content kinds.